The Evolution and Domestication of Dogs
Dogs are believed to have diverged from or descended from wolves a hundred thousand years ago, but it was only until 15,000 years ago when significant morphological changes started to occur. Women in Ancient Rome had the first evidence of little lap dogs, which supposedly cured stomach aches.
